Kirill Kulemin (born 13 October 1980) is a Russian rugby union player currently playing for USA Perpignan in the Pro D2. Born in Moscow, he previously played rugby league for Dynamo Moscow and his talents were noticed playing in a Challenge Cup match against professional Super League teams. His position is at lock or in the forwards. Kulemin left London Welsh to join Sale Sharks for the 2013/14 season.[1] After a spell with Sale Sharks, it was confirmed Kulemin will return to France to join USA Perpignan, who were relegated to the Pro D2.[2]

He is an international player for Russia.[3]
